Children's State/Local Health Insurance Programs | Florida Kidcare - MediKids

Eligibility

Children under age 5 who are not eligible for Medicaid or Children's Medical services and have no health insurance.

Application process

Applications are available online at www.floridakidcare.org or by calling the toll-free number at 1-888-540-KIDS (5437).

Required documents

Social Security number (SSN) or Pending SSN, Documentation of Earned and Unearned Family Income, Immigration or Lawful Permanent Resident and Identity

Fees

Payments for subsidized coverage are $15 - $20 per month per family; full-pay options range from $116 - $159 per child, per month, depending on age & selected options.

Health insurance program is administered by the Agency for Health Care Administration, is designed for Florida's toddler children from age 1 until the 5th birthday, who are not eligible for Medicaid or Children's Medical Services and has no other forms of health insurance.

Providing organization

Florida Kidcare
Provides four income-based state health insurance programs for Florida children from birth until the 19th birthday. The programs are Medicaid, MediKids, Florida Healthy Kids and the Children’s Medical Services (CMS) Health Plans.
